Transaction Detail

txidcb077f673f8670d403045a1df486c100b6bd8b534f176b7836f78965960c1f54
Block Hasha381d5a9905fa0f4abe2bee978c45216ef42f30e593f5dc5d541d43f9e425e0c
Time2018-06-22 23:51:14 UTC
Version1
Confirmations8081453

Transaction

InputOutput
coinbase:
03ab61180102062f503253482f